Portuguese Sports Bar Limited

9563 118 Ave Nw Edmonton AB T5G 0N9,
Edmonton

Business Summary:

Address :9563 118 Ave Nw Edmonton AB T5G 0N9
City :Edmonton
Phone :780-474-6788